### FAQ: How do I register event schemas from my plugin?

Plugins for Threnody publish schemas to the Coppervein registry at startup. Use `threnody schema push` with your plugin manifest; versions are immutable once accepted. Breaking changes require a new major version and a compatibility note. Validation failures return the offending field path. If your registry token is revoked or lost, the sandbox tenant can be re-initialized from the recovery console. Enter the recovery passphrase shown below when prompted.

vault phrase of kawep-tahog = ulaix-briath

Management Meeting Minutes — for the Incoming Director

Subject: Pellworth Coffee Co. franchise agreement. Terms reviewed and approved: ten-year term, three sites in the Eastmarch corridor, standard royalty structure. Legal confirmed exclusivity language is final. Open item: signage cost split, owed to franchisee by month end. Training schedule confirmed for the Bramleigh location. Intentions for further regional expansion are set out in the note below.

board note of yajeg-yaweg: The pricing group signed off on a budget of $4.9 million for Project Quenix. The renewal with Sormirek Freight closes at $6.1 million a year, 37 percent below the last contract.

# Harlowe Point Office Closure — Managers Only

The Harlowe Point office will close at the end of the fiscal year. Finance should wind down the local cost centre, settle outstanding vendor commitments, and transfer recurring charges to the Denwick ledger. Severance and relocation costs are provisioned under the restructuring reserve. Asset disposal proceeds route to central treasury. Quarterly reporting continues unchanged until closure. The broader planning note is recorded below.

internal memo for yahag-hahig: Belwynix Group plans to lower the Silir list price by 62 percent in May.